The Determination of Indicator Polychlorinated Biphenyls in Food by Gas Chromatography
Objective:To establish a gas chromatography method for the determination of indicative polychlorinated biphenyls(PCBs)in food.Method:After the samples were extracted by water bath heating and shaking,they were purified by sulfuric acid and chromatography column,and then determined by gas chromatography-electron capture detector(GC-ECD)and quantified by internal standard method.Result:The linear relationship of 7 indicative PCBs was good in the range of 5~800 μg·L-1,and the correlation coefficients were all greater than 0.999.The limit of quantification was 0.12~0.35 μg·kg-1,the RSD was 1.36%~2.55%,and the recovery rate was 62.87%~98.62%at the spiked level of 9 μg·kg-1.Conclusion:The established method has high sensitivity and good stability.PCBs were detected in 22 kinds of aquatic animals and their products randomly collected from 4 categories in Shanwei market,and the detection rate was 4.55%,and no excessive phenomenon was found.
